Hi Hummer H3 fans .. I recently removed my front drive shaft to replace the boot ... once out i started it up to try and move it out of the rain but it would not go anywhere... the front hub was spinning but the rear wheels would not drive..... So am i missing something or do i not have the selector in the right setting... Happy Hummering

Yes you are missing something. The H3 has StabiliTrack and Traction Control. It will send power to the wheel with least resistance. When you removed the front drive shaft the front became the wheels with least resistance and the power was sent to the front which is NOT hooked up.

The only way to move an H3 with front drive shaft removed is by placing the T Case in Lock, which sends power split evenly between front and rear.
